PROCESS FOR PRODUCING RARE EARTH ACTIVATED ALKALINE EARTH METAL FLUORIDE HALIDE-BASED PHOTOSTIMULABL

Disclosed are a process for producing a rare earth activated alkaline earth metal fluoride halide-based photostimulable phosphor, which possesses excellent brightness and graininess and, at the same time, possesses excellent moisture resistance, a rare earth activated alkaline earth metal fluoride halide-based photostimulable phosphor produced by the process, and a radiological image conversion panel. The production process is a process for producing a rare earth activated alkaline earth metal fluoride halide-based photostimulable phosphor represented by the following general formula (1) by sintering of a phosphor precursor mixture. The production process is characterized by comprising a step of preparing one phosphor precursor constituting the phosphor precursor mixture by adding an aqueous inorganic fluoride solution to a reaction mother liquor containing a barium halide dissolved therein to form a crystal precipitate while concentrating the reaction mother liquor to remove the solvent from the reaction mother liquor, a mixing step of mixing the phosphor precursor with another phosphor precursor, and a firing step of firing the phosphor precursor mixture. General formula (1) : Ba1-xM2xFX : aM1, bLn, cO
